Default Yamaha warrior hard to start

So my bike will start no problem while I have the battery connected to the charger but once I unplug it it’s hard to get it to start again. The battery is new 210cca so not sure here

what is the voltage on the battery? You may have got a dud battery or your starter, or solenoid is wearing out and needs more voltage than the battery can supply. How does it start if you bypass everything and jump the terminals across the solenoid or starter?
